数据库加载
组件介绍
“数据库加载”(SQL Table) 控件支持从数据库中读取数据(目前支持 Microsoft SQL Server, PostgreSQL, MySQL, Oracle, MongoDB)。
“数据库加载”(SQL Table) 支持直接读取指定表信息,同时也支持用户编写查询SQL语句加载查询结果数据。加载数据时用户需指定属性类型方便系统处理。加载数据后可对数据进行数据预处理、数据查看、数据挖掘模型构建等操作。
- 输入:
- 无
- 输出:
- data:数据集
页面介绍
点击 “数据库加载”(SQL Table) 控件查看参数配置页面,如下图所示:
参数选项
选项 | 说明 | 取值范围 | 样例值 |
---|---|---|---|
类型 | 连接数据库的类型 | Microsoft SQL Server | PostgreSQL |
数据库地址 | 数据库连接地址 | ip或域名 | 127.0.0.1 |
端口 | 连接端口号 | 0~65535 | 5432 |
数据库名 | 数据库名 | 非空字符串 | test |
模式 | schema,针对PostgreSQL数据库 | 非空字符串 | public |
用户名 | 数据库连接用户名 | 非空字符串 | postgres |
密码 | 数据库连接密码 | 非空字符串 | 123456 |
配置完成后,点击“连接”按钮,将会弹出 “数据库加载”(SQL Table) 控件的交互页面(如下图所示)。在交互页面中选择所需的表名即可加载该表中的数据,进行进一步处理。
使用案例
“数据库加载”(SQL Table) 控件一般作为一个工作流的开端,加载数据进行相关处理。如下图所示的工作流中 ,使 “数据库加载”(SQL Table) 控件加载数据,连接 “ 查看数据”(Data Table) 控件查看数据。
案例中配置 “数据库加载”(SQL Table) 连接mysql数据库加载数据库中 iris 数据集,案例中控件执行结果如下图所示: